Because of Braxton's exit, none of the couples were sent home this week, even though co-host Tom Bergeron kept it suspenseful by not revealing that would be the case until the final seconds of the show.
Here's where the stars stand going into next week's finals:
Irwin and Hough: 60
Carlos PenaVega and Witney Carson: 60
Alek Skarlatos and Lindsay Arnold: 57
Nick Carter and Sharna Burgess: 54
Next week, the stars compete in a two-episode finale on Monday and Tuesday. Read on for highlights from the semi-finals.
